Ronald W. Hodge, 76, of Rural Lovington went to be with the Lord at 12:50 a.m., Thursday September 15, 2011.
 
A service to celebrate Ron’s life will be at 11:00 a.m., Monday, September 19, 2011 at Dawson & Wikoff Funeral Home, Mt. Zion with Pastor Ed Bacon officiating. Burial will be in Mt. Zion Township Cemetery. Visitation will be from 3:00 p.m. until 6:00 p.m. Sunday at the funeral home. Memorials may be made to Mt. Zion Christian Church or Pulmonary Rehab Clinic of St. Mary’s Hospital. 
 
Ron was born April 10, 1935 in Decatur, the son of Charles Willis and Grace Mary (Bonds) Hodge. He married Patricia Simpson on March 7, 1959. He was a farmer. He was a member of the Mt. Zion Christian Church. Ron truly enjoyed fishing especially in Iron River, Wisconsin.
He was an avid St. Louis Cardinal Baseball fan.
 
Surviving is his wife: Patricia of rural Lovington; son Randall Hodge of Toluca Lake, CA; daughter: Ronda Davis and her husband Jeff of Lovington; brothers: Don Hodge and his wife Barb of Mt. Zion and Leonard Hodge and his wife Kathy of Mt. Zion; sister: Mary Leffelman and her husband John of Amboy; grandchildren: Kurt Davis and his wife Rachel of Carthage, Amanda Pharis and her husband Joe of Lovington, Megan Davis of Mattoon, Mallory Brittenham and her husband Ryan of Monticello, and Rick Davis of Lovington; great-grandchildren: Owen Pharis, Zane Pharis, Noah Brittenham, Sarah Beth Davis, and Isaac Davis.
 
Ron was preceded in death by his parents.
 
The family would like to express their sincere gratitude to Cheryl, Peggy and Pat at St. Mary’s Lung Rehab and to Dave, Eric and Josh of Heckman Health Care for all their care and compassion during Ron’s illness.
 
Ron was a loving husband, dad, grandpa and great-grandpa who had a deep commitment to his Christian faith and a love for the Lord. He will be sadly missed.
